McCullough-Hyde Memorial Hospital is a vital community asset that receives mixed reviews. Many patients praise the nursing staff for their compassion and the hospital for its personal touch. However, there are frequent complaints about the ER wait times and some doctors being perceived as dismissive or rude. It's a classic small-town hospital experience.
